Mission Success: Rocket Lab Launches 2nd Hypersonic Test Mission in Three Months for Defense Innovation Unit

Rocket Lab's HASTE rocket achieved 100% success in deploying DART AE, advancing reusable hypersonic technology for the US Department of War and its allies.

  • On Feb. 27, 2026, Rocket Lab Corporation launched HASTE rocket 'That's Not A Knife' from Rocket Lab Launch Complex 2, marking its second DIU hypersonic test in three months and seventh overall.
  • HASTE, an acronym for hypersonic accelerator suborbital test electron, functions as a suborbital testbed and has rapidly become a commercial hypersonic test platform in under two years.
  • The mission deployed DART AE, a scramjet-powered aircraft by Hypersonix, into a suborbital hypersonic flight environment at several times the speed of sound, with Matt Hill calling it a major milestone.
  • Rocket Lab reports 100% mission success across all HASTE launches, supporting hypersonic testing and national security, as the company celebrates its third launch of the year.
  • Rocket Lab's wider portfolio shows more than 1,700 missions backing test services, while Hypersonix said the flight moves it closer to reusable hypersonic capabilities for allies.
